Rhinocryptidae

plural noun
Rhi·​no·​cryp·​ti·​dae | \ ˌrīnəˈkriptəˌdē\

Definition of Rhinocryptidae

: a family of South American birds closely related to Furnariidae — see tapacolo

History and Etymology for Rhinocryptidae

New Latin, from Rhinocrypta, type genus (from rhin- + -crypta, from Greek kryptos hidden) + -idae
